Lawn Mower Leaking Gas

In June I purchased a used Lawn-Boy Silverpro Model # 10324 lawn mower (2-3 yrs old), with a Duraforce 6.5 hp 2 cycle self-propelled engine.
The last few times I have used the mower I have noticed that it has been leaking a dark brown fluid from the under side of the muffler assembly. This leaking does not happen while the engine is running but usually the day after I have used the mower.
Now the last time I used the mower, besides this brown fluid, I also noticed the smell of raw gasoline the next day. After inspection I found that the air filter, located on the back of the engine, was soaked in gas. I tilted the mower onto its back wheels and gas came running out of the air intake. I believe this intake goes into the carberator.
I cleaned everything up and inspected all hoses and connections and all appear to be in good condition. I did notice more gas leaking out today.
Any thoughts or ideas on both problems would be greatly appreciated.

Hello tbone946!

Sounds like you need to clean the carb at the least, rebuild it at the most. Remove the carb bowl and clean it out and clean the needle and seat well. If it continues to leak, you may need to replace the needle. Let us know how it goes!
